The Eaton molded case circuit breaker is engineered for reliability and precision in electrical distribution systems. The NZM series stands out with its robust design, allowing for exceptional performance as a four-pole circuit breaker. Built to handle a nominal current of 500A with integrated features for short-circuit protection and overload settings, this product ensures your system is safeguarded against electrical faults. Designed for both industrial and commercial applications, it conforms to international standards, thus assuring high compliance and operational efficiency. With an easy installation process and versatile mounting options, this circuit breaker simplifies integration into existing panel designs, making it an essential component for enhancing electrical safety and operational resilience.

Developed with a thermomagnetic release for added protection against overloads

Offers a high short-circuit breaking capacity, ensuring immediate fault isolation

Incorporates comprehensive thermal stability verification for long-lasting performance

Designed with IP20 and IP66 protection ratings for various environmental requirements

Features a compact design, enabling easy installation in confined spaces

Facilitates flexible connection options for various conductor types

Engineered to operate efficiently in a wide range of ambient temperatures

Conforms to RoHS standards, promoting environmental safety
